Storing and Using Auto-Dial Numbers Storing and Using Auto-Dial Numbers You can store your most frequently dialed numbers for automatic dialing. Numbers can be stored in the Common book or the Private book. ♦ Up to 99 numbers can be stored in the Common book. These numbers are shared with the machine and other cordless handsets, and can be stored using a cordless handset as explained below, or the machine as explained on page 88. ♦ Up to 50 numbers can be stored in the Private book. Each cordless handset has its own Private book, and the numbers are stored using the cordless handset as explained below. 1 Press SEARCH . Cordless handset display: SELECT SEARCH ▲: COMMON ▼: PRIVATE 2 Press to select the Common book, or to select the Private book. Example: Common book selected COMMON DIAL ▲▼: SEARCH FUNCTION: ENTRY FUNCTION 3 Press /PAUSE . ENTER TEL # _ 4 Enter the number by pressing the number keys. (Note: A space cannot be entered.) • To clear a mistake, press HOLD . ERASE • If a pause is required between any of the digits to access a special service FUNCTION or an outside line, press /PAUSE . The pause appears as a hyphen (two seconds per pause). Several pauses can be entered in a row. 48
